Deaflympics flame lighting in Paris

Friday 5 July

After lighting a flame at Stade Pershing in Paris, home of the world’s first Silent Games in 1924, deaf cyclists carried the flame to the Bistrot de la Porte Dor�e. It was at this caf� that deaf sports leaders first had the idea for the games. From Paris, the flame will be carried to Sofia, in time for the opening ceremony of the Deaflympics.

The Sofia 2013 Deaflympics will be the 22nd edition of the games that started in Paris. More than 3,000 deaf athletes are expected from more than 90 countries, competing in 18 sports.
